New Owners for Central Flying Academy

CHANGE OF OWNERSHIP

Central Flying Academy was formed in August 2001. It has significant potential for expansion, but this calls for the financial backing of a large organization. After a career that spans 22 years in the South African Air Force and three years with this company, I feel the time is right to elevate the business to a higher level. We envisage major expansions to Central Flying Academy within the next 24 month period.

Please read an extraction of the press release announcing change of ownership:

“Babcock Brands, a division of Babcock Africa, has taken to the skies – literally – following the acquisition of the Grand Central, Midrand-based Central Flying Academy, the second largest private pilot training facility in the country.’

Mark Hughes, managing director of Babcock Brands; explain the rationale for the acquisition when he says: “Our UK holding company operates a flying instruction outfit called Babcock Defence Systems that provides elementary flight training through to more advanced levels for the UK Defence Forces. We are looking to make our business more synergetic with that of our UK principals and we regard this step as a furthering of the process to align our South African Businesses with those of our parent company.”

Please note that business will not be affected at all and that Willie Marais and all personnel will remain in their respective positions.
